Transaction 80fe27ce8fa0b7d796741755f785690fe608f4a7e43ce063687f288656e1c51f

1 Input
2 Outputs
  • 80fe27ce8fa0b7d796741755f785690fe608f4a7e43ce063687f288656e1c51f:0
  • value  825000
    address  3NDe6DfiMBpCZBjNmLa9jvzLDpMwkAmYYg
  • 80fe27ce8fa0b7d796741755f785690fe608f4a7e43ce063687f288656e1c51f:1
  • value  35684652
    address  39Vj3RpRh1NoST64t2z3GWhdeaa2ZgQPWn